Portugal faces Sweden and France meets Ukraine in World Cup

France finished second in Group I, behind Spain, this season. France, previous World Cup winners (1998) and finalists in the 2006 World Cup, are off to visit Ukraine to continue their bid for qualification. Ukraine were the runners-up of Group H, falling behind England. Portugal and Cristiano Ronaldo need to defeat rival Sweden and Ibrahimovic in the upcoming playoff if they are to get a place in the Brazil World Cup next year. The sides were selected to play against each other after losing out on automatic qualification earlier this year and will play in Zurich, the home of FIFA, to gain their World Cup place. Sweden will be travelling to Lisbon to play in the first leg on Friday 15th of November, with the return match being played in Stockholm just four days later. Iceland, the lowest ranking of the eight teams in the playoffs with a 46 world rank, are to host the first leg match against Croatia. The draw in Zurich also established that Romania will face Greece in another European play-off. All play-offs are scheduled to take place on Friday 15th of November and Monday 19th November.
